Ben’s Canada crossing, 2014–2015
Winter 2014–2015
In the winter of 2014–15, Ben and his then wife, Natalia, embarked on an epic 2,000km cycle and ski journey across Canada from south to north in the middle of winter, from the US border south of Winnipeg up to the north of the Hudson Bay.

Ben’s Auyuittuq expedition, 2014
March – April 2014
In 2014, after his first polar training in Iqaluit, Ben and his then wife, Natalia put their training into practice with their own mini-expedition, a two-week/300km ski journey through the Auyuittuq National Park in Canada, a spectacular wilderness area of the country dominated by tremendous peaks…

Ben and Erica’s Hardangervidda training expedition
April 2026
In April 2026 we did our first training expedition together: eight days hauling pulks across the Hardangervidda plateau and north of Finse, through cloud, whiteouts, a blizzard and a hailstorm (and one perfect day of sun!).
